Output 62ae8b515fe7d03e76452f650b297a655a4a67ce882e5dd3e95300bfe4adc202:1

value
5025381
script pubkey
OP_0 OP_PUSHBYTES_20 8d28a5efadfa0964d0575c81b84c524c063d2ec2
address
bc1q3552tmadlgykf5zhtjqmsnzjfsrr6tkzrqqhn3
transaction
62ae8b515fe7d03e76452f650b297a655a4a67ce882e5dd3e95300bfe4adc202
confirmations
104
spent
true